[The design of a model of the experimental cervical spondylosis].

ABSTRACT
A model of the cervical spondylosis in the rabbits was established with press-injection of saline into the space between C5 and C6. The formation of the osteophytes at the posterior corner of the vertebra and the slight compression of the spinal cord were found in 4 months after the injection. The swelling, degeneration and rupture of the annulus fibrosus, the regeneration of fibrocartilage cells and the deposition of calcium extending to the posterior part of the vertebral body were observed under light microscope. The pathological changes were similar to those of the cervical spondylosis in the human being.
